Today, we’re exploring the history of the Welsh village of Llawhaden in Pembrokeshire…
Home to the impressive Llawhaden Castle, in it’s day a luxurious fortified mansion for the bishops of St David's. The village also hosts the remains of a medieval chapel hospital, with an impressive vaulted stone roof creating a haunting atmosphere with limestone stalactites forming on the arches... And down by the river, St Aidens, a medieval church reconstructed in the 1800s, in the centre of the rear wall is an inscribed stone pillar, hinting towards an older sacred site.
